Essential Ingredients and Possible Substitutions
To create your delightful Caramel Apple Crisp Cheesecake, gather these essential ingredients:
- Cream cheese: This creamy base is the heart of your cheesecake, providing that rich and delightful texture.
- Sugar: It sweetens your cheesecake filling and caramel. You can use brown sugar for added depth.
- Apples: Granny Smith apples bring a tart contrast, but Honeycrisp or Fuji work beautifully as well.
- Heavy cream: Adds richness to your cheesecake filling.
- Cinnamon and nutmeg: These warming spices elevate the flavor, giving it that perfect autumn touch.
- Graham cracker crumbs: Form the base of your crust, providing a buttery crunch.
- Butter: Use unsalted, melted butter for the crust.
- Caramel sauce: Store-bought or homemade, this is the delicious finishing touch!
Don’t worry if you’re missing a few ingredients. For instance, you can substitute granulated sugar with coconut sugar for a healthier option. If you want to lighten things up a bit, consider using Greek yogurt instead of heavy cream. You can even swap out apples based on seasonal offerings or personal preferences—just keep an eye on the sweetness of the fruit!
Step-by-Step Recipe Instructions with Tips
Creating the perfect Caramel Apple Crisp Cheesecake is straightforward. Follow these steps:
Prepare the crust: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). In a mixing bowl, combine the graham cracker crumbs with melted butter and sugar until the mixture resembles wet sand. Press this firmly into the bottom of a springform pan. Bake for 8-10 minutes or until lightly golden. Let it cool.
Make the filling: In a large bowl, beat the cream cheese with a hand mixer until smooth. Gradually add in sugar, then mix in the heavy cream. Add eggs one at a time, mixing until just incorporated. Finally, fold in cinnamon and nutmeg.
Prepare the apples: While the filling is blending, peel and core your apples. Slice them evenly and sauté them in a skillet with a touch of butter, sugar, and a sprinkle of cinnamon until slightly soft and caramelized. Allow them to cool.
Assemble the cheesecake: Pour half of the cheesecake filling over the cooled crust. Spread the sautéed apples evenly over the filling, followed by the remaining cheesecake mixture.
Bake: Place the pan in the oven and bake for about 50-60 minutes or until the edges are set but the center has a slight jiggle. Turn off the oven and let the cheesecake sit for an hour inside to prevent cracks. Please resist the temptation to open the oven door for the first 40 minutes!
Chill and serve: Once cooled to room temperature, chill the cheesecake in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ours (overnight is even better). When ready to serve, drizzle with rich caramel sauce and a sprinkle of cinnamon.
Tips: For a smoother consistency, ensure your cream cheese is at room temperature before beating. Also, consider letting the cheesecake cool slowly rather than rushing it outside into the fridge. The patience is worth it!
Cooking Techniques and Tips
How to Cook Caramel Apple Crisp Cheesecake Perfectly
To achieve the most poetic balance of textures and flavors, follow these simple cooking techniques:
Room temperature ingredients: Always allow your cream cheese and eggs to reach room temperature. This ensures smooth mixing, leading to a creamy cheesecake without lumps.
Water bath method: For an even bake and to keep your cheesecake moist, consider placing your springform pan into a bigger baking pan filled with hot water when baking. This creates a gentle steam environment.
Cooling process: After baking, cooling the cheesecake in the oven helps prevent shocking it with cold air, which can lead to cracks. Once slightly cooled, transfer directly to the fridge for optimal texture.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Even seasoned bakers can run into hiccups. Here are common pitfalls to steer clear of:
Overmixing: Mixing the batter too much can incorporate excessive air, leading your cheesecake to puff up and crack in the oven.
Skipping the chill: If you’re eager to serve right away, remember that chilling is essential for achieving that sliceable beauty.
Neglecting the topping: Caramel can seize up; if it does, gently reheat it with a splash of cream to return its lusciousness.

How do I store leftover Caramel Apple Crisp Cheesecake?
This delightful cheesecake can be kept in the refrigerator, covered well with plastic wrap or a lid. It stays fresh for about 5-7 days—though I doubt it will last that long!
Can I freeze Caramel Apple Crisp Cheesecake?
Absolutely! To freeze, first let it cool completely. Wrap well with plastic wrap followed by aluminum foil. It should keep for about 2-3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, thaw it in the refrigerator overnight for optimal flavor.

Caramel Apple Crisp Cheesecake
- Total Time: 90 minutes
- Yield: 8 servings 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
A delightful Caramel Apple Crisp Cheesecake that combines creamy cheesecake with warm caramelized apples and a buttery crisp topping, perfect for autumn gatherings.
Ingredients
- 16 oz cream cheese
- 1 cup sugar (can use brown sugar)
- 3 apples (Granny Smith recommended)
- 1/2 cup heavy cream
- 1 tsp cinnamon
- 1/2 tsp nutmeg
- 1 1/2 cups graham cracker crumbs
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 1 cup caramel sauce
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Combine graham cracker crumbs, melted butter, and sugar; press into the bottom of a springform pan. Bake for 8-10 minutes until golden, then cool.
- Beat cream cheese until smooth, gradually add sugar and heavy cream, then add eggs one at a time. Fold in cinnamon and nutmeg.
- Peel and slice apples, sauté in a skillet with butter, sugar, and cinnamon until caramelized; cool.
- Pour half of the cheesecake filling over the cooled crust, add sautéed apples, and top with remaining filling.
- Bake for 50-60 minutes until edges are set; let it cool in the oven for an hour.
- Chill in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ours, then serve with caramel sauce.
Notes
Ensure cream cheese is at room temperature for a smooth consistency. Consider a water bath for even baking.
